Transaction e4ac0595b80424f87e207fd0f175f9aa217947250543e1c209c2ae6e51e2749b

49 Input
1 Outputs
  • e4ac0595b80424f87e207fd0f175f9aa217947250543e1c209c2ae6e51e2749b:0
  • value  20027909
    address  bc1qeqmud3593upp5sem79nmgyl5ncsfqhxjm2wmw3